Cursed: All four of the Arizona Cardinals first four draft picks are injured, with two out for the season

Arizona Cardinals rookie injuries are threatening their rebuild as Jeremiyah Love, Chase Bisontis, Carson Beck and Kaleb Proctor all face setbacks.
- • All four of the Arizona Cardinals' first four draft picks are currently injured.
- • Chase Bisontis and Kaleb Proctor are ruled out for the entire season.
- • Jeremiyah Love and Carson Beck are dealing with ongoing ankle and rib injuries.
The Cardinals intended for these four rookies to serve as the foundational pillars for their organizational rebuild. Instead, the team must rely on unproven depth due to these immediate physical setbacks.
